Second Step: Install Client Application Across Your Network Automatically
Now that you have the server installed, its time to install the client software to the rest of your network. The Client Application is an executable file which can install without user interaction. Nothing will be displayed on the screen as you install it to a computer.
You can manually install the module to each PC you want to monitor OR create a basic logon script using the instructions in the User Guide. When a logon script is used, the software will automatically install itself on each PC if it is not already installed..
Third Step: Monitor and Control Your Entire Network
After you have installed the Client Application to each computer you wish to monitor, its time to start using Net Orbit. Open the Admin Application on your PC. Then click the Add New Connection command. Select the computer you wish to add from the drop down list or enter the internal IP of a particular computer.
After you add your connections you can then select any or all of them on the left side of the interface. You can then perform any of Net Orbit's commands, including Play which views the selected computers on the right side. All functions can be accessed now anytime you bring up the Admin Application.
